Thank yo...Very interesting post!<br />I learned from it.<br />Thank you for sharing.Geraldine Adamshttps://www.blogger.com/profile/07431793929816318982noreply@blogger.comtag:blogger.com,1999:blog-37372269.post-70859970224488574132011-10-20T16:32:46.382-07:002011-10-20T16:32:46.382-07:00Per paypal policy, its seller's responsibility...Per paypal policy, its seller's responsibility to deliver the package to the stated address. Unless they have proof that it made it there, the seller will lose any paypal claim.<br /><br />This goes to show that any store collecting via paypal needs to make sure they charge enough shipping for insurance if they feel that they cannot cover a loss.<br /><br />Also, store policy will not override paypal policy so there is no point in making your store policy contradictory. <br /><br />Thanks!El at Tantalizing Stitcheshttps://www.blogger.com/profile/00389212676480537372noreply@blogger.comtag:blogger.com,1999:blog-37372269.post-8821151826468626932011-10-20T16:22:00.210-07:002011-10-20T16:22:00.210-07:00Great info in this post.
